Church History


June 9, 1957
Opening rally at Worth School Auditorium

June 16, 1957
First services with 13 in Sunday school and 17 in church.
Most of these were members of the Ashburn Baptist Church.
Pastor was James Zaspel. Among the canvassers was a teenager named BobHeppeler.

August 4, 1957
First Evening Service.

September 8, 1957
Church organized as First Baptist of Worth with 23 charter members.

September 15, 1957
First Baptismal service. Two of the three were Mr. & Mrs. Clyde Garrison.

April 26, 1958
Groundbreaking for new church.

September 11, 1958
Purchased parsonage at 7435 W. 114th Place, Worth.

October 18, 1959
Dedication of original building. Charles Draper and Clyde Garrison were members of the building committee.

August 11, 1965
Changed name to First Baptist Church of Palos Hills.

1968-1969
Annex constructed and paid for on completion.

December, 1972
Additional lot purchased(new parking lot).

June, 1973
Lot south of French Home purchased.

September 7, 1975
Groundbreaking for new church.

March 24, 1976
Prayer meeting held in new auditorium with first Sunday service conducted on March 28, 1976.
